The sheriff of San Juan County, Utah, is scheduled to appear in court July 25th on charges related to an incident in which he allegedly pointed an unloaded rifle at an employee in 2014 and pulled the trigger. Sheriff Rick Eldredge, Chief Deputy Alan Freestone, and Deputy Robert Wilcox all face a number of charges filed by the Utah Attorney General’s Office related to the incident. The San Juan Record reports that prosecutors are seeking a change of venue in the case. The men have remained on active duty.
